This course is suitable for students aged 19 and over.

This course will help you develop your knowledge and skills to improve your own employability, self-development and social awareness.

During this course, you will learn how to identify and deal with problems, consider what key qualities are required for employment and discover how to present information in a CV.

You will develop your job search skills, self-presentation and interview preparation, before working towards identifying and applying for job vacancies.

What will I study?

Lessons may include written and practical tasks as well as group discussions and direct delivery by the tutor.

Topics covered, include:

  • How to complete a job application – online and paper-based
  • How to be successful at interviews – face to face and video
  • How to create a CV and adapt transferrable skills to job specification
  • How to work successfully in an office or at home and working safely online

How is it assessed?

Students will be assessed through completion of a workbook.
